How Bradenton's Climate Tests Your HVAC System
Our location on Florida's Gulf Coast creates unique challenges for HVAC systems. The relentless humidity means your air conditioner works overtime to remove moisture from the air. Summer heatwaves push equipment to its limits, while occasional winter storms can surprise homeowners with heating needs. Salt air near our beaches can corrode outdoor units, and our abundant pollen can clog filters and coils faster than in drier climates. Whether you have an older gas furnace in a West Bradenton home, a modern heat pump in a new Parrish development, or ductless mini-splits in a Cortez condominium, our environment demands specialized attention.
Common HVAC Problems We See in Bradenton Homes
Every week, we help Bradenton homeowners with predictable seasonal issues. AC units that stop cooling during peak afternoon heat are frequent summer calls. Furnaces that won't ignite during our brief cold snaps common in January. Frozen evaporator coils from dirty filters, clogged condensate lines causing AC units to leak water inside homes—these moisture-related issues are especially prevalent in our humid climate. Emergency HVAC vs Same-Day vs Routine Service: Knowing the Difference
Understanding when to call for what type of HVAC service in Bradenton can save you stress and money. Emergency service is for immediate safety threats: carbon monoxide alarms, gas smells, no heat in freezing weather, or no AC during dangerous heat. Same-day service is perfect for problems that are urgent but not immediately dangerous—like reduced cooling on a hot day or a furnace that's making strange noises. Routine service includes scheduled maintenance, planned replacements, or minor repairs that can wait a few days. Most HVAC service in Bradenton falls into the routine or same-day categories, but knowing when to upgrade to emergency response protects your family.
HVAC Service Cost Breakdown for Bradenton Homeowners
We believe in transparency about HVAC service costs. Here's what Bradenton homeowners can typically expect: A standard diagnostic fee usually ranges from $75 to $125 during business hours. Emergency call-out fees for after-hours, weekend, or holiday service generally add $100 to $200. Labor rates in our area typically run $85 to $135 per hour, with after-hours premiums of 1.5 to 2 times the regular rate. Parts are additional, and major replacements or installations may require permits from Manatee County. For example, a weekend emergency repair of a failed capacitor during a heatwave might cost $300-$500 including after-hours fees, while a routine AC tune-up during business hours typically runs $100-$150.

Safety Checklist While Waiting for Help
- If you smell gas, evacuate immediately and call your gas utility from outside
- If your CO alarm sounds, get everyone outside and call for help
- If safe to do so, shut off your HVAC system at the thermostat
- Keep clear of electrical panels and HVAC equipment
- Move children, elderly family members, or anyone with health conditions to a safe location
- Never attempt gas line or high-voltage electrical repairs yourself
Local Codes and Why Licensed Service Matters
Bradenton and Manatee County have specific requirements for HVAC work. Proper furnace venting is crucial for preventing carbon monoxide buildup. Handling refrigerant requires EPA Section 608 certification—illegal handling harms our environment. Major system replacements often need permits to ensure they meet Florida building codes. Using licensed HVAC service in Bradenton means your system will be safe, efficient, and compliant with all local regulations.
